**Ticket PRV-4417 — Proctor queue stalls at session handoff**

ExamWarden's proctoring queue stops dequeuing when a candidate reconnects mid-session. Workers mark the slot busy but never release it, so the queue backs up within ten minutes under load. Repro: force-disconnect during identity recheck, rejoin, watch queue depth climb. Fix lands in the Marrowgate branch; needs cherry-pick before Friday cut. Rollback plan: disable reconnect grace window via flag. Verified against the candidate build, referenced below.

pipeline stamp: htk4_ae36

Handover — pool car key cabinet, Feldane Yard site.

Contractors collect and return keys themselves from today; front office no longer handles it. Cabinet is mounted inside the site hut, left of the noticeboard. Rules: sign the sheet every time, one vehicle per crew, keys back by 17:30 sharp. Fuel receipts go in the tray, not the cabinet. Report any missing keys to the site agent immediately — don't wait until end of shift. Cabinet has a keypad lock; the current code is below.

door code, yagap-bahof: bdg-O-05

**Vendor note: Inkmill markdown pipeline**

Rendering for Parchway docs is outsourced to Inkmill under an annual contract, renewing each March. They handle sanitization and PDF export; we own the upload queue. SLA: 4-hour response on rendering failures. Escalate only after two failed retries. Their support desk is reachable at the address below.

billing contact of hahaf-baguf = zorael.tammir.jorius@sivrelhq.internal

## Deployment: Offline Mode

FieldScribe builds ship with offline mode disabled. Enable it only for survey crews working the Varnholt basin, where connectivity is unreliable. Sync resumes automatically once the device reconnects; conflicts resolve last-write-wins. Do not enable offline mode on shared tablets — cached credentials persist for 72 hours. Bump the cache schema version on every release. Set the following values before packaging:

service settings:
quenath:
  log_level: info
  metrics_host: metrics.quenath.tolvaqlabs.internal
  pin: 1407
  pool_size: 8